About The Position

The Senior Consultant - Business Intelligence role helps design, test, and deploy solutions that address the business needs of the department focusing on reporting and dashboards to deliver analytics and insights. This entails knowledge of the business process and applications that support them. They meet with project stakeholders, Sr management leaders and business partners throughout the organization to engage, gather business requirements and determine the application technology strategy. Additionally, they collaborate and consult with Enterprise Architecture (EA), Data Governance, external vendors, and internal IT resources. This position also plays a valuable role in the development, enhancement and deployment of applications following the MFS system-development life cycle while working to release projects and maintenance items for the benefit of our clients and internal business partners.
